- Jaffy Company recently reported $150,000 of sales, $75,500 of operating costs other than depreciation, and $10,200 of depreciation. The company had $16,500 of outstanding bonds that carry a 7.25% interest rate, and its federal-plus-state income tax rate was 35%. How much was the firms net income? The firm uses the same depreciation expense for tax and stockholder reporting purposes.
A. $35,167.33
b. $37,018.24
c. $38,966.57
d. $41,017.44
e. $43,068.31
